History: Entheogens have been used for millennia in spiritual rituals and traditional healing practices
Within the realm of “Plants Of The Gods”, the historical usage of entheogens holds immense significance. Entheogens have played a pivotal role in shaping spiritual practices and traditional healing systems across diverse cultures worldwide.
- Ancient Rituals: Entheogens have been central to religious ceremonies and spiritual practices since ancient times. For instance, the Eleusinian Mysteries in Greece involved the consumption of kykeon, a brew containing entheogens, to induce profound mystical experiences.
- Shamanic Practices: Shamans have traditionally used entheogens as tools for healing, divination, and communication with the spirit world. Ayahuasca, a brew made from the ayahuasca vine, is a well-known example used by shamans in the Amazon rainforest.
- Traditional Medicine: Entheogens have been incorporated into traditional medicine systems for centuries. In Ayurvedic medicine, for example, cannabis and other entheogens are used to treat various ailments.
- Cultural Significance: The use of entheogens has shaped cultural beliefs and practices. The peyote cactus, revered by Native American tribes, is an embodiment of this cultural significance.
These historical facets collectively underscore the profound impact of entheogens on human cultures and spirituality, highlighting their multifaceted role in shaping religious rituals, healing practices, and cultural traditions.

Medicine: Modern research explores their therapeutic potential for mental health conditions and addiction.
Within the realm of “Plants Of The Gods”, modern medicine is investigating the therapeutic potential of entheogens for mental health conditions and addiction. This exploration marks a significant chapter in the understanding and application of these sacred plants.
- Mental Health Treatment: Studies suggest that entheogens, such as psilocybin and LSD, may alleviate symptoms of depression, anxiety, and PTSD. Research is ongoing to determine optimal dosages, administration methods, and integration strategies.
- Addiction Recovery: Entheogens are being explored as potential aids in addiction recovery. Ayahuasca, for example, has shown promise in reducing cravings and withdrawal symptoms in individuals struggling with substance abuse.
- Brain Function: Research using neuroimaging techniques is examining the effects of entheogens on brain function. Studies indicate that these substances may enhance neuroplasticity, promote neurogenesis, and reduce inflammation in brain regions associated with mood regulation.
- Therapeutic Applications: Entheogen-assisted therapy is gaining attention as a novel approach to mental health treatment. Trained therapists guide individuals through carefully controlled sessions, creating a safe and supportive environment for exploring inner landscapes and promoting healing.
These advancements in medical research are shedding light on the potential benefits of entheogens in addressing mental health challenges. Further studies are needed to establish safety protocols, determine long-term efficacy, and integrate these substances responsibly into therapeutic settings.
